  • What is a Sone and How Can You Improve Yours? - Broan-NuTone
    The first thing that you need to know is that sones are a measurement of sound, similar to decibels The difference between sones and decibels is that sones are linear, meaning that 1 0 sone is exactly half as loud as 2 0 sones, and 2 0 sones is half as loud as 4 0 sones
  • Sone | Decibel, Loudness Acoustics | Britannica
    Sone, unit of loudness Loudness is a subjective characteristic of a sound (as opposed to the sound-pressure level in decibels, which is objective and directly measurable) Consequently, the sone scale of loudness is based on data obtained from subjects who were asked to judge the loudness of pure
  • Sones Ratings and Charts - Better Soundproofing
    Sones are a measure of loudness itself Sone values are generally preferred to phon values because sones are a linear scale If the sone value triples, the perceived loudness triples This is consistent for the entire frequency range The phon scale is logarithmic and less intuitive

  • SONE Definition Meaning | Dictionary. com
    Sone definition: a unit for measuring the loudness of sound, equal to the loudness of a sound that, in the judgment of a group of listeners, is equal to that of a 1,000-cycle-per-second reference sound having an intensity of 40 decibels See examples of SONE used in a sentence

  • Sone Explained
    The sone is a unit of loudness, the subjective perception of sound pressure The study of perceived loudness is included in the topic of psychoacoustics and employs methods of psychophysics Doubling the perceived loudness doubles the sone value
  • What does SONE mean? - Definitions. net
    sone A sone is a unit of perceived loudness It is used to measure subjective impressions or sensations of loudness of sound as it is perceived by human ear One sone is equivalent to the loudness of a pure tone of frequency 1,000 hertz at 40 decibels above the listener's threshold of hearing
